Like Peggy Hall, I became associated with SBO about 20 years ago. I was looking for a company to distribute my products but every response I received was "call us when you've established a sales track record" - how was I supposed to establish a sales track record when no one would carry my products?? Then one day I called Bly Berkin. I expected another NO but SBO was trying to get off the ground and I had a connection with Catalina owners but most importantly Bly & I came from similar backgrounds and we connected and additionally developed the SAIL TRIM FORUM.

SBO has sold my products to every country in the world except China & Russia -- don't know what it is with those 2 countries. Our business relationship has been unique -- I never personally met Bly & Phil and we never signed a contract -- our relationship was based on a verbal hand shake, which is unique in today's world.


I hope SBO is successful for another 20 years.
